Dangote Refinery on Saturday tagged as fake the allegation that it sells petrol between N1, 015 and N1, 028/litre.
Some oil marketers had reportedly on Friday said the price of petrol, produced by the Dangote Refinery stood between N1, 015 and N1, 028/litre.
They said it would be reasonable to import the product from the international market as the landing cost stood at N978.01/litre as of October 31, 2024.
Reacting to the development, Dangote Group on its X handle dismissed the allegation as ‘fake news’.
VAM reported that the Independent Petroleum Marketers Association of Nigeria, IPMAN, had claimed that the price of fuel from Dangote Refinery, as of last week, was higher than in other places.
Yakubu Suleiman, National Assistant Secretary of IPMAN stated this on Friday while fielding questions on Arise Television’s Morning Show programme.
Suleiman said IPMAN members would go where the price is lower and where they get profit, adding that they have to pity Nigerians.
